Abstract

Disclosure herein are systems and methods for dynamically adjusting infrastructure items, such as street lights, construction signage, and/or other lighting elements. The systems and methods may include receiving environmental data for a sector containing the infrastructure items. A quality of infrastructure effectors located within the sector may be determined. A deviation from a standard infrastructure quality associated with the infrastructure effectors may be determined. A setting of the infrastructure items located in the sector may be changed to minimize the deviation from the standard infrastructure quality.
